updated on Tue Jan 17 12:00:36 UTC 2012
[aur-mirror.git] / network-manager-applet-gtk2 / PKGBUILD
blobd887dd45c5b801a8cfec17697ba0ced675de84d2
1 # Maintainer: Aljosha Papsch <papsch.al@gmail.com>
2 # Contributor: Benjamin Wild <benwild@gmx.de>
4 pkgname=network-manager-applet-gtk2
5 _pkgname=network-manager-applet
6 pkgver=0.9.1.90
7 #_pkgepoch=${pkgver%.*}
8 _pkgepoch=${pkgver%.*.*}
9 pkgrel=1
10 pkgdesc="GNOME frontend to NetWorkmanager compiled for gtk2"
11 arch=('i686' 'x86_64')
12 license=('GPL')
13 url="http://www.gnome.org/projects/NetworkManager/"
14 depends=('networkmanager' 'gtk2' 'libgnome-keyring'
15          'notification-daemon' 'libnotify' 'gnome-icon-theme'
16          'mobile-broadband-provider-info' 'gconf' 'iso-codes')
17 makedepends=('intltool' 'gtk-doc')
18 optdepends=('gnome-bluetooth: for PAN/DUN support')
19 options=('!libtool')
20 provides=('network-manager-applet')
21 conflicts=('network-manager-applet')
22 install=network-manager-applet.install
23 source=(http://ftp.gnome.org/pub/GNOME/sources/$_pkgname/${_pkgepoch}/$_pkgname-$pkgver.tar.bz2)
24 sha256sums=('8df010463b70b71598bfccf258c5a5ec115f3acf1f13c641f245dc9a66d21328')
26 build() {
27   cd "${srcdir}/${_pkgname}-${pkgver}"
28   ./configure --prefix=/usr --sysconfdir=/etc --with-gtkver=2  \
29       --localstatedir=/var \
30       --libexecdir=/usr/lib/networkmanager \
31       --disable-static \
32       --disable-maintainer-mode
33   make
36 package() {
37   cd "${srcdir}/${_pkgname}-${pkgver}"
38   make GCONF_DISABLE_MAKEFILE_SCHEMA_INSTALL=1 DESTDIR="${pkgdir}" install
40   install -m755 -d "${pkgdir}/usr/share/gconf/schemas"
41   gconf-merge-schema "${pkgdir}/usr/share/gconf/schemas/${_pkgname}.schemas" --domain nm-applet ${pkgdir}/etc/gconf/schemas/*.schemas
42   rm -f ${pkgdir}/etc/gconf/schemas/*.schemas